How do people cope with the challenges of staying sober? In this episode, Alyssa shares her morning reflections, kicking off the day with a moment of silence for alcoholics and their loved ones. She recites the Serenity Prayer, setting a hopeful tone for those in recovery. Alyssa's daily reflections focus on avoiding controversy, emphasising how self-righteousness and unsolicited advice can be detrimental.
She candidly admits that while she's not a professional, she can share her own experiences of navigating life's challenges without alcohol, highlighting the value of AA's steps and traditions. Alyssa also touches on the impact of alcohol on family life, noting that recovery is a journey that requires patience and understanding from all involved. Her insights remind listeners that recovery is not just about abstaining from alcohol but also about mending relationships and taking responsibility.
As the episode wraps up with the Lord's Prayer, Alyssa leaves listeners with a simple yet powerful message: "Keep coming back. It works if you work it."
